Chicago hopes for kids provides educational support for children living in Chicago’s homeless shelters. it is our mission to provide our students with the resources and encouragement needed to succeed academically.
Volunteers will assist children grades K-5 with academic support as an after school mentor in small group setting (1-3 students).
Responsibilities include:
No teaching experience is necessary, but helping your children, grandchildren, nieces and nephews with their homework is definitely a plus! You will assist with homework help, literacy support and reading activities.

Mission Statement
AARP is a nonprofit, nonpartisan, social welfare organization with a membership of more than 37 million that helps people turn their goals and dreams into real possibilities, strengthens communities and fights for the issues that matter most to families. RSVP is a federal program which began in 1971 and is administered by theCorporation for National and Community Service. RSVP is America’s largestvolunteer network for people age 55 and over. There are nearly 500,000 participants across the nation who are providing valuable services in their communities.
Description
RSVP members may choose from a list of agencies in Chicago that have a signed agreement with the RSVP office. Volunteer assignments are made according to volunteers’ skills and interests and the needs of the stations.
Each volunteer position has different time requirements. RSVP strives to help you find opportunities that match your interest and scheduling needs. You will then work with your station supervisor to finalize your schedule. This will include time for orientation and training.
